I bought my truck an 03 6.0 last summer had 155k on the clock. About 10 or 12k miles after I got it the damn egr and oil cooler failed and it started leaking coolant into my block I parked it in my driveway and didn't move it until I could afford a egr delete and cleaned out all my intake manifold and oil cooler. With that being said.. I learned my lesson and words of advice look at your engine when you go and test drive it. Look at the coolant reservoir and make sure it isn't brown colored. Your coolant should be gold and you'll know if its dirty. And another thing if you do end up buying it do the egr delete kit cause it will just be a matter of time before it fails it would be more wise to dish out some money 300$ or so to get the delete kit then have the egr trash your motor.

A thorough inspection should tell you if it's worth the money. how smooth does it sound on start up? if it sounds like it's missing (just on start-up) it'll likely need an injector or two before long. If it runs rough while warm, then she'll need some new injectors right away. '03 EGR coolers have a better success rate than the newer ones, but still are known to go out. How clean is the coolant? if it's dirty, or 'original' looking, plan on replacing the oil cooler, and doing an egr delete at the same time. The engines are actually quite good. There's just a bunch of tards out there that don't know how to take care of their stuff, or push it beyond it's limits. I know it doesn't help sell stuff for the shop I work at, but I tell anyone who puts a chip or programmer on a 6.0 to plan on doing head studs sooner or later.
To sum it up:
rough running only when cold= will need new injectors before too long, but not urgent, consider using rev-x to bring them back to life. it actually works.
rough running all the time= probably bad injector(s)
dirty coolant= better plan on replacing the oil cooler- do EGR delete at same time
Check condition of ATF. People who stay on top of servicing these trucks get tons of miles out of them. If it's bad, it could be an indication of how the truck's been treated
Use SCT if you plan on doing a chip/ programmer. others can destroy a trans. Also keep in mind that no matter what you buy if it has wheels or boobs, it'll have problems, but if it's been maintained, I wouldn't worry about it. let us know if you get it.
